What is *Hangman's Curse (2003)* about?

When students at Rogers High School begin falling gravely ill after invoking a ghostly legend, a covert investigative team steps in to uncover the cause. Is it supernatural retribution, a dangerous new drug, or something far more sinister? The clock is ticking as they race to protect the school from its own dark secrets.

About Hangman's Curse (2003) — Horror-Mystery Where Urban Legends Come to Life

In the eerie halls of Rogers High School, a mysterious illness begins targeting bullying students who dare to scream the name of a vengeful ghost—Hangman's Curse. As panic spreads, whispers of supernatural forces and sinister drugs swirl through the student body, each theory more chilling than the last. Enter the Veritas Project, a secretive team of investigators racing against time to uncover the truth before more lives are lost. With lives hanging in the balance, they delve into the dark corners of the school's past, where fear and hatred fester beneath the surface.

Directed by Rafał Zielinski and starring David Keith and Mel Harris, *Hangman's Curse (2003)* blends horror, mystery, and thriller elements into a gripping narrative that explores the consequences of cruelty and the power of urban legends.
